Repair Methods For Partial Replacement

If a repair is required, all spot-welded bonded joints and certain bonded joints can be replaced with welded joints if no suitable body adhesive is available.

Do not make the repair with only the same weld points and seams as originally used in production, because these alone are not adequate.

The repair methods are shown separately on the following information.

NOTE:

If the instructions call for additional weld points, these should be applied in one step.

Do not place additionally between the original weld points.

Gas-shielded arc plug welding should only be performed after spot-welding.

This prevents any increased shunt current when spot-welding.

Ensure good weld penetration at all connections.

Seal off repaired flanges and apply cavity sealant.
